Ep 2First Noble Truth

E

The following is a talk from Against the Stream Nashville Founder, Dave Smith, that he gave while teaching a retreat at New Life Foundation in Thailand. Dave discusses the "Wisdom of Dissatisfaction" as it relates to Buddhist teaching and practice. The First Noble Truth is the cornerstone of the path to developing a deeper understanding of the ways in which we self-generate stress and often dismiss, avoid, or avert our attention from what is painful and difficult. Often, in our efforts to avoid pain, we often create more pain. Dave discusses the importance of turning towards the difficulty of life as a way of liberating the heart and deepening our understanding of human nature. Enjoy! Ep 1Spiritual Urgency

E

Andrew discusses the role of commitment and motivation in the undertaking of spiritual practice. He talks about the pali sanskrit word, samvega (“spiritual urgency”) as a foundational element of Buddhist practice. This talk spotlights the five reflections (Upajjhatthana Sutta) as a tool for remembering the temporariness of our life, health, and wellbeing. By taking time to reflect on the impermanent nature of life, we can remember how important it is to be present and available for the many challenges and joys that make life meaningful.
